Description
About AdeptAg
AdeptAg LLC is a North American leader in controlled environment agriculture, integrating innovative growing, automation, and irrigation solutions for customers both domestic and international. We support today’s growers with advanced automation systems designed to improve efficiency, productivity, and long-term operational performance.
The Role
The Quoting/Product Specialist – Automation & Controls is responsible for preparing detailed, accurate cost estimates and formal proposals for automation and environmental control system projects within commercial greenhouse and controlled environment facilities.
This role focuses on capital equipment projects, system retrofits, PLC-based control systems, and full-scope automation installations. The position works cross-functionally with Sales, Engineering, Procurement, and Product Management to define scope, assess risk, and ensure proposals align with company margin and execution standards.
Key Responsibilities
Prepare detailed project estimates for automation and controls systems
Review drawings, electrical schematics, P&ID's, and project specifications
Collaborate with Engineering to confirm system architecture, programming scope, and commissioning requirements
Coordinate vendor and subcontractor pricing
Conduct margin analysis, risk assessments, and contingency planning
Develop formal proposals including scope of work, assumptions, exclusions, timelines, and commercial terms
Track revisions and maintain documentation in CRM/ERP systems
Support Sales during technical discussions and customer meetings
Participate in project turnover meetings to ensure smooth transition to Project Management
Support Product Management initiatives related to automation and controls offerings
Qualifications
Valid driver's license required for work-related travel
Key Skills & Abilities
Strong knowledge of industrial automation and control systems
Advanced proficiency in Microsoft Excel, including formulas, cost modeling, and scenario analysis
Ability to perform cost modeling, margin analysis, and identify financial impacts
Ability to identify scope gaps and assess technical risk in project bids
Strong organizational and time management skills with the ability to manage multiple concurrent bids
Clear and effective technical writing skills for proposal development
Ability to effectively collaborate with cross-functional teams, including Sales, Engineering, and Operations, to support successful project outcomes
Education & Experience (Required)
Associate's degree in electrical engineering technology, Automation Technology, Industrial Technology, or related field, or equivalent combination of technical education and relevant automation estimating experience.
1+ years of experience in automation or electrical/mechanical system design support, industrial or building automation projects, or electrical contracting environments
Demonstrated experience interpreting electrical schematics, system layout drawings, and project specifications
Experience estimating material, labor, programming, and commissioning costs for automation projects
Preferred Qualifications
Bachelor’s degree in electrical engineering, Controls Engineering, Industrial Engineering, or a related technical discipline
Experience in controlled environment agriculture (CEA) or greenhouse automation systems
Experience working with design-build or engineered-to-order systems
